What Really Caused the Spiral?

According to those close to Houston, two major factors were the turning point causing the rapid weight loss and extreme drug use that characterized the early 00’s for the singer. For one, it was her father’s decision to sue her for $100,000,000 in compensation. “I think it broke something inside of her that she could never repair.”

Secondly, it was the gaping hole left by Robyn Crawford’s departure. Crawford distanced herself from Houston after tension with Bobby Brown became intolerable. In the end though, Brown admitted that without Crawford, his late wife lost the person who fought the most to get her clean.

“I really feel that if Robyn was accepted into Whitney’s life, Whitney would still be alive today,” Brown said. “Whitney didn’t have close friends with her anymore.” For the record, Crawford now lives with her partner, Lisa, and they have twins.
